DOI: DOI: 10.1117/3.2265063Online resources: Additional physical formats: Also available in print version.Summary: An icon in the world of optics, Emil Wolf laid the foundations of contemporary physical optics by documenting the concept of spatial coherence before lasers were introduced. This powerful concept has influenced many areas of optical science and engineering, several of which are discussed in this book and are intended to pay homage to one of the great minds of physical optics.
